sqlc-rust-postgres

sqlc plugin for tokio_postgres and postgres

Important

This plugin is no longer maintained. Please use sqlc-gen-rust instead.

Options

NOTE: This plugin supports json only.

db_crate

The supported values for db_crate are tokio_postgres, postgres, and deadpool_postgres. Default is tokio_postgres.

enum_derives

Strings added here will be included in the generated enum's derive attributes.

row_derives

Strings added here will be included in the generated XXXRow struct's derive attributes.

overrides

By default, this plugin does not support third-party crate types. If you wish to use them, add an entry here.

copy_types

Specifies additional types that should be passed by value instead of reference for better performance. Database-generated enums and primitive types (i32, i64, bool, etc.) are automatically optimized.

"copy_types": [
"postgres_money::Money",
"uuid::Uuid"
]

This optimization reduces function call overhead by avoiding unnecessary references for copy-cheap types.

When an unsupported DB type is encountered, you might see an error like:

$ sqlc generate
# package rust-postgres
error generating code: thread 'main' panicked at src/query.rs:308:17:
Cannot find rs_type that matches column type of `pg_catalog.numeric`
note: run with `RUST_BACKTRACE=1` environment variable to display a backtrace

In this case, add the following entry to overrides:

 "overrides": [
{
"db_type": "voiceactor",
"rs_type": "crate::VoiceActor"
},
{
"db_type": "money",
"rs_type": "postgres_money::Money"
},
+ {+ "db_type": "pg_catalog.numeric",+ "rs_type": "rust_decimal::Decimal"+ }
]

Setup develop environment

Install protoc.

sudo apt-get install protobuf-compiler

Ref: https://docs.rs/prost-build/latest/prost_build/#sourcing-protoc

Install just and run setup

cargo install just
just setup-tools

Run sqlc

just generate

Update sqlc proto

Copy from https://github.com/sqlc-dev/sqlc/blob/main/protos/plugin/codegen.proto
